Imperial Swan Hotel and Suites Lakeland

Imperial Swan Hotel and Suites Lakeland descritpion
Located 40 minutes from Busch Gardens in Tampa and 50 minutes from Disney World, this hotel offers an on-site spa, restaurant, and rooms with a microwave and refrigerator.
The accommodations at Lakeland Imperial Swan Hotel and Suites include cable TV and air conditioning. A coffee maker, hair dryer and ironing facilities are provided.
Imperial Swan Hotel and Suites Lakeland hosts a gym and outdoor swimming pool. Laundry and dry cleaning services are available.
Lakeland Linder Regional Airport is 15 minutes from Imperial Swan Hotel and Suites Lakeland. Cypress Gardens Adventure Park is 30 minutes from the hotel.
